In Kolkata, there are two reputable hospitality management schools: the International Institute of Hotel Management (IIHM) and the International School of Hospitality Management (ISHM). The IIHM, founded in 1994, is a private institute that has been named by The Economic Times as one of the best hospitality education brands for 2020. IIHM, which offers international courses and degrees, has a good placement record, but it is more expensive than ISHM. ISHM, which was founded in 2011, is ISO accredited and widely regarded as the best hotel management institute in Kolkata, providing affordable hospitality courses with comparable placement

The documents required at the time of admission are:
- Provisional allotment letter & seat acceptance letter of WB JECA 2022
- Admit card of WB JECA 2022
- Rank card of WB JECA 2022
- Class 10 admit card/birth certificate for verification of date of birth
- Marksheet of class 10 examination
- Marksheet of class 12 examination
- Marksheet of all semesters of bachelor’s degree
- Valid domicile certificate in WB JECA-prescribed format for West Bengal domicile candidates
- Valid SC/ST certificate issued by the government of West Bengal (if applicable)
- Duly filled in no-upgradation form in WBJEEB prescribed format

The tuition fees for both the universities that is Seacom Skills University - SSU and AOT- Academy of Technology, is around the same. For SSU the tuition fees per year is 3.03 Lakhs, whereas for AOT the tuition fees per year is 2.6 Lakhs for lateral entry and 3.6 Lakhs for the regular courses. Seacom Skills University - SSU is comparatively a little more expensive than AOT- Academy of Technology.

Academy of Technology has a very decent rate of 99.3% placement, whereas Seacom Skills University placements may go as high as 80%. Talking about the package, both the colleges offer an average package of around 4LPA and is visited by top recruiters like TCS, Infosys, IBM etc. Academy of Technology provides better placement options as compared to Seacom Skills University.
